Choosing the Best Professional Dog Clippers: A Buyer’s Guide
Finding the right dog clippers makes grooming much easier. Professional clippers last longer and cut better. This guide helps you pick the perfect set for your furry friend.
Key Features to Look For
Good clippers have features that make grooming smooth and safe. Think about what your dog needs before you buy.
Motor Power and Type
The motor is the heart of your clippers. Professional clippers usually have strong motors.
- Rotary Motors: These are very powerful. They work well for thick, double-coated, or matted dogs. They can get hot faster.
- Pivot Motors: These are quieter and cooler running. They handle light to medium coats well.
Corded vs. Cordless
Decide if you want the freedom of movement or constant power.
- Corded: You never worry about the battery dying. They often have stronger, consistent power.
- Cordless: They offer great flexibility. Check the battery life; good ones run for 60 minutes or more.
Noise Level
Loud clippers scare many dogs. Look for models specifically designed to be quiet. Lower decibels mean a happier grooming session.
Important Materials Matter
The materials used affect how long the clippers last and how they cut.
Blade Material
Blades must stay sharp. Most quality blades use stainless steel or ceramic.
- Stainless Steel: Durable and common. Good quality steel holds an edge well.
- Ceramic: Stays cooler than metal blades, which helps prevent burns on your dog’s skin. They are also very sharp.
Clipper Housing
The casing should feel sturdy in your hand. Plastic housings are lighter but may break if dropped. Metal housings offer better durability and often help dissipate heat.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Small details separate good clippers from great ones.
Heat Management
Clippers generate heat as they run. High heat can burn your dog’s skin. Look for clippers with built-in cooling vents or those that use ceramic blades, as they run cooler.
Weight and Ergonomics
You will hold these clippers for a long time. Heavy clippers cause hand fatigue. Comfortable, well-balanced clippers improve your control and make the job faster. Test the grip if possible.
Adjustable Speeds
Variable speed settings are a huge advantage. A slower speed works for sensitive areas or fine trimming. A higher speed tackles thick mats quickly.
User Experience and Use Cases
Consider your dog’s coat type and your grooming experience level.
Coat Type
Match the clipper power to the coat.
- Thick/Double Coats (e.g., Huskies, Goldens): You need high-power motors and sharp, robust blades to cut through the undercoat.
- Fine/Single Coats (e.g., Poodles, Yorkies): Quieter, mid-range power clippers often work perfectly well.
Maintenance Needs
All clippers need cleaning and oiling. Professional models usually have easier-to-remove blade sets for deep cleaning. Check how often the manufacturer recommends sharpening or replacing the blades.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Professional Dog Clippers
Q: How often should I oil my professional clippers?
A: You should oil the blades every 10 to 15 minutes of continuous use. This keeps them cool and sharp. Always oil them after cleaning, too.
Q: Can I use human hair clippers on my dog?
A: No, you should not. Dog hair is thicker and often coarser than human hair. Dog clippers have stronger motors designed for that resistance.
Q: What is the difference between a #10 blade and a #7 blade?
A: The number on the blade relates to the cut length. A #10 blade leaves the hair very short (about 1/16 inch). A #7 blade leaves the hair longer (about 1/8 inch). Shorter numbers mean shorter cuts.
Q: How do I stop the blades from overheating?
A: First, use blade coolant spray regularly during long sessions. Second, switch to ceramic blades, which naturally run cooler. Third, take short breaks to let the metal cool down.
Q: Are cordless clippers as powerful as corded ones?
A: Modern high-end cordless clippers are very powerful. However, corded models provide maximum, uninterrupted power, especially for very tough coats.
Q: What should I do if the clippers start pulling the dog’s hair?
A: Pulling usually means the blades are dull or dirty. Stop immediately. Clean the blades thoroughly and apply clipper oil. If the problem continues, the blades need professional sharpening or replacement.
Q: What are guide combs used for?
A: Guide combs (or guards) snap onto the blade. They keep the blade a specific distance from the skin, ensuring you leave a consistent, longer length of hair.
Q: Is it better to buy a clipper set or just the clipper body?
A: A set is usually better for beginners. Sets come with multiple guide combs and different blade sizes, giving you options for various coat styles.
Q: How do I clean the hair out of the clipper head?
A: Unplug the clippers. Use the small cleaning brush provided with the kit to sweep out all trapped hair from between the teeth. Then, use a little oil to wipe the blades clean.
Q: What speed setting should I use on matted fur?
A: Start with a lower speed to carefully work around the mats, reducing the chance of cutting the skin. Once the main matting is broken up, you can switch to a higher speed for the bulk of the coat removal.
